Develop and extend your KS2 class’s reading and writing skills using the classic story of ‘The Twits’ by Roald Dahl. Inspired by the two gruesome characters and their horrible habits, these The Twits lesson plans challenge your children to write instructions, non-chronological reports, playscripts and descriptions, as well as developing their reading skills in these fun and revolting themed lessons.

Use this complete Features of a Playscript KS2 lesson pack to investigate and analyse the different features of playscripts with your Year 4 class. Using the lesson input slides provided, challenge the children to compare the features of a playscript to features of other genres of writing. The model text included with this lesson pack can be used to aid discussion around this genre of writing and help your class idenitfy successful features.
